测试理论.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
测试理论,软件测试理论,测试理论基础,测试理论知识,软件测试理论和方法,软件测试,测试理论和方法,软件测试从入门到精通,测试方法,政策理论水平测试题

测试基础 1、软件测试的目的: 证明(表达软件能够工作)→ 检测(发现错误)→ 预防(管理质量) 2、测试执行: 单元测试执行(UT):一个测试用例的测试执行; 集成测试执行( IT):一个测试用例集的测试执行; 系统测试执行(ST):不同测试阶段的测试执行。 3、软件测试的主要工作: a. 检视代码,评审开发文档; b. 进行测试设计,写作测试文档 (测试计划、测试方案、测试用例等); c. 执行测试,发现软件缺陷,提交缺陷报告,并确认 缺陷最终得到了修正; d. 通过测试度量软件质量。 4、 软件危机的出现主要表现在: a. 由于缺乏大型软件开发经验和软件开发数据积累, 开发工作计划很难制定; b. 开发早期需求分析不够明确,造成开发后期矛盾 集中暴露; c. 不遵循开发规范,开发文档不完整,软件难以维 护; d. 缺乏严密有效的软件质量检测手段,交付给用户 的软件质量差。 5、 软件危机的后果: a. 软件质量不高,很难稳定; b. 软件项目延期,进度无法控制; c. 成本增加,无法控制预算。 6、 软件危机的根源: a. 根据摩尔定律,硬件发展很快,相应对软件 系统的期望越来越高; b. 软件系统复杂性提高,需多人合作; c. 软件开发是人的智力活动,无法用已有的产业 工程方法来组织管理。 7、 软件生命周期的各个阶段: 计划→ 需求分析→ 设计→ 编码→ 测试→ 运行→ 维护 8、 软件研发流程类型: 瀑布模型、螺旋模型、RUP流程、IPD流程。 9、 常见的引入缺陷的原因: a. 开发过程缺乏有效的沟通,或者没有进行沟通; b. 软件复杂度越来越高; c. 编程中产生错误; d. 需求不断变更; e. 项目进度的压力; f. 不重视开发文档; g. 软件开发工具本身隐藏的问题。等等…… 软件质量管理 软件质量管理体系: 软件质量管理体系: ISO9000 :【 ISO9000 ISO9001(核心) ISO9004】 ISO9000:2000版标准 ISO9000:制定管理理念和原则 ISO9001:标准对组织质量管理体系必须履行的要求 做了明确的规定,是对产品要求的进一进 补 充。(梳心) ISO9004:是组织进行持续改进的指南标准。 CMM : (后边具体介绍) 六西格玛 : 六西格玛管理法(强调组织能力) 本质:全面质量管理,而不仅仅是质量提高手段 1、 软件质量的定义: 一个实体的所有特性,基于这些特性可以满足明显的或隐含 的需求。而质量就是实体基于这些特性满足需求的程度。 2、 软件质量的三个层次: a. 符合需求规格; b. 符合用户显示需求; c. 符合用户实际需求。 3、 影响软件质量的因素: 流程、技术、组织 4、 八项质量管理原则的意义: a. 是质量管理的理论基础; b.用高度概括易于理解的语言所表述的质量管理的 最基本、最通用的一般性规律; c. 为组织建立质量管理体系提供了理论依据; d. 是组织的领导者有效的实施质量管理工作必须遵循的原则。 5、CMM 软件质量成熟度模型 由于美国软件工程研究所(SEI)受美国国防部委托立项。 1991年推出CMM1.0版,1993年提出CMM1.1版 现在开发CMMI(CMM Integration) 6、软件能力成熟度模型CMM(提倡过程决定质量) CMM1:初始级,Inltial,不可预测并且缺乏控制; CMM2:可重复级:Repeatable,可重复以前的主要经验;

文档评论(0)

docindpp +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档